Right-to-left heart mechanical `crosstalk': The role of functional hydraulic properties of the myocardium
Proceedings of the First Joint BMES/EMBS Conference : serving humanity advancing technology, Oct. 13-16, 99, Atlanta, GA, USA, v 1, pp 226-226
01 Jan 1999
Abstract
Myocardial tissue coupling mechanisms responsible for right-left heart (RH-LH) interaction were studied by selectively modulating coronary arterial-venous compartments. In altering the mechanics and energetics of LH, the intramural hydraulic forces, originating in RH, constitute an intrinsic regulatory mechanism of cardiac function.
